Follow-up from the Quenchly queue outage: we're finally upgrading the Marrowbus broker from 3.x to 5.x, and you're picking this one up. Heads up, the consumer ack semantics changed between versions, so every downstream team needs a compat shim before we flip the switch. Do the staging cluster first, soak it for a week, then schedule prod with the platform crew. All the migration steps, known gotchas, and the rollback plan are written up here.

operations page: https://jira.qorvelsys.internal/browse/pages/browse/pages

Q: Is there somewhere quiet to work between site visits?

A: Yes — the quiet room on the top floor of Marrowden Court is open to visiting contractors, not just staff. It's the glass-walled room past the kitchenette, no bookings needed, just keep calls to a minimum. Heads up: the lift only goes to level five, so take the last flight of stairs. The quiet room door locks automatically, so punch in the shared code below to get in.

badge for haduf-bafop: bdg-O-78

- [ ] Step 7: Archive cold storage buckets (Glacierline tier). Confirm both ceremony witnesses are present, verify bucket manifests match the Oxbow ledger, then seal the archive key shares. Plugin authors may observe but not handle shares. Once sealed, the archive index itself is encrypted and can only be reopened with the passphrase below.

vault phrase of badup-hahig = tamael-aldael-kelmir-istael-fenok-istwyn-tamius-jorath-oliion

- Pool car keys: if you're driving between the Renwick Yard and our Ashby Point site, grab a key from the grey cabinet by the loading bay door at Fenholt Logistics. Sign the clipboard first — Marta on reception checks it daily and will chase you otherwise. Return keys by end of day, even if you're back tomorrow. The cabinet lock needs the code below to open.

staff pass of kawip-hawef = bdg-QLP-2

**Minutes — Management Meeting, Harwick Plant Capacity**

Attendees: all department heads. Ms. Voss presented utilisation figures showing Line 3 at 94% through peak season. Options discussed: second shift versus expansion of the Dellmore annex. No decision taken; costings due next month. Mr. Abende asked that the strategic context be recorded below for reference.

confidential, bagap-kahog: Only 9 of the 80 pilot accounts renewed Oliath, so a churn review is set for April 15.